International Shipping and Jewelry Airfreight to Dubai
Shipping jewelry internationally, particularly to Dubai, requires meticulous planning and strict adherence to safety measures and customs regulations. Here is a
comprehensive guide on how to air transport jewelry to Dubai.
Step 1: Prepare for Shipping
The first step involves assessing the jewelry items to be shipped and preparing them for transportation. Ensure that each piece of jewelry is properly packaged in a secure and tamper-resistant container. Label the package clearly with the destination address, contact details, and any necessary shipping documents. Additionally, you should declare the contents and value of the package accurately for
customs clearance.
Step 2: Select an Airfreight Carrier
Choose a reliable airfreight carrier that has experience in handling precious and delicate cargo such as jewelry. Make sure to inquire about their handling procedures and safety measures for such items.
Step 3: Arrange Export Documentation
Prepare all necessary export documentation, including commercial invoices, shipping certificates, and any other relevant paperwork required for
customs clearance. It is important to ensure that all documents are accurate and comply with the regulations of both the exporting and importing countries.
Step 4: Arrange Import Permits and Customs Clearance in Dubai
Obtain necessary import permits and ensure
customs clearance in Dubai. Research the customs regulations of Dubai to ensure that your jewelry complies with the requirements. You may need to provide additional documents or information to facilitate
customs clearance.
Step 5: Arrange Insurance Coverage
Consider purchasing insurance coverage for your jewelry shipment. This will protect your investment in case of any damage or loss during transit. Ensure that the insurance policy covers the full value of the jewelry and any associated costs.
Step 6: Track and Trace Your Shipment
Monitor your shipment regularly using the tracking services provided by your airfreight carrier. This will help you stay updated on the status of your jewelry shipment and ensure its safe arrival in Dubai.
Step 7: Handle Customs Clearance Upon Arrival in Dubai
Once the jewelry arrives in Dubai, handle
customs clearance promptly. Provide all necessary documents and information to facilitate the process. Once customs clearance is complete, you can arrange for delivery or collection of your jewelry.
